Victories for Sturm and Austria – LASK in Lustenau 1:1

news/WHAT/Sunday 09/11/22 18:58:05

Sturm Graz and Wiener Austria celebrated away wins on Sunday in the eighth Bundesliga, three days following their European Cup appearances. The “Veilchen” prevailed 3-0 at TSV Hartberg and are now sixth, the Styrians won 2-0 at Austria Klagenfurt and thus consolidated third place. The second LASK did not get more than 1: 1 at fourth-placed promoted Austria Lustenau and is already three points behind leaders Red Bull Salzburg.

The defending champion had already won 3-0 in Ried on Saturday. Rapid suffered a 1:3 home defeat once morest WAC, WSG Tirol and bottom SCR Altach drew 0:0.
